Dance of the Dissident Daughter by Sue Monk Kidd
Sue was a “conventionally religious, churchgoing woman, a traditional wife and mother” with a career as a Christian writer until she began to question her role as a woman in her culture, her family, and her church. From a sexist encounter in a suburban drugstore to rituals in the caves of Crete, Kidd takes us through the fear, anger, healing, and transformation of her awakening.
